4. HMRC Making Tax Digital (MTD) Submissions

  • When you connect your organisation to HMRC MTD and submit a VAT return, you authorise Countee to transmit the return data to HMRC on your behalf.
  • You are solely responsible for the accuracy and completeness of the figures entered. Countee transmits the data you provide; we are not a tax adviser and do not verify the correctness of your VAT calculations.
  • Once a return is submitted and accepted by HMRC, it cannot be amended through the platform. Any amendments must be made directly with HMRC.
  • You must ensure your VAT Registration Number (VRN) and business details are correct before submitting.
